Transaction 72a7525c30252c518dc8e9036ccbc6e64d676a89ec69f84d039b50f74f127eec

1 Input
2 Outputs
  • 72a7525c30252c518dc8e9036ccbc6e64d676a89ec69f84d039b50f74f127eec:0
  • value  1402006
    address  3PoHbhAsr73GxHsznGTdY2ZixgLAstg7U8
  • 72a7525c30252c518dc8e9036ccbc6e64d676a89ec69f84d039b50f74f127eec:1
  • value  7238233525
    address  1HLUhrYQvDoKygict2WVGNryoHrcg8w7zi